Local Events and Training: Macomb County 4-H Science Blast 2011 October 6, 2011 The 4-H Science Blast will introduce youth and their families to science related activities. These exciting activities explore science related matters without even realizing science concepts are in motion! Youth ages five to 19 will have the chance to engage in science activities in key areas such as environmental science, plant science, biology, and water quality. This is a FREE event but registration is required by calling 586-469-6431. The event will take place at 6:30 at the VerKuilen building 21885 Dunham Road, Clinton Township, MI 48036. 4-H Model Rocketry Each spring and summer Macomb County 4-Hers can participate in this project area where they learn to build a rocket, launch it and can then exhibit it in the Armada fair. Contact the 4-H office at 586.469.6431 for more information.
Annually in October Young people across the nation are encouraged to discover, explore and learn about alternative energy and biofuels. Each October, Macomb County invites all young people to participate in a FREE National Science Day Workshop held locally where they will conduct hands on experiments.
